About the OrganisationThe Benevolent Society's vision is to build a just society where all Australians can live their best life. For more than 200 years we have supported people at the margins of society: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ander Australians; children, young people, and their families; older people; carers and people with disability. We are an independent, non-religious service provider which supports people to live life their way.
As part of The Benevolent Society\'s vision, we are strongly committed to reconciliation with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ander people of Australia. We remain steadfast in our commitment to promoting the economic, political, and social inclusion of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ander peoples.
About the roleAre you ready to shape the financial future of a dynamic organisation? We\'re seeking a sharp, analytical mind to support our Director of Finance in delivering high-impact financial modelling, insightful reporting, and data-driven analysis to our CFO and key stakeholders. This pivotal role will harness advanced analytics tools to uncover trends, build robust forecasting models, and empower smarter decision-making across the business.
Duties- Financial Strategy & Analysis: Develop financial models for tenders, performance projections, and M&A projects; identify improvement and de-risking opportunities with stakeholders.
- Reporting & Insights: Build KPI reports with cross-functional teams and mine data from systems to create drill-down analyses that drive actionable insights.
- Operational & Project Support: Contribute to finance projects like ERP implementation and management reporting enhancements; assist with audits, funder reporting, and benchmarking.
- Stakeholder Engagement: Maintain strong connections with managers and stakeholders; provide financial coaching and support to help teams achieve business goals.

- Professional Credentials & Experience: Qualified CA/CPA with 10+ years in management accounting, financial analysis, and business partnering.
- Technical & Analytical Expertise: Advanced skills in financial modelling, Power BI model building and reporting, and navigating complex client data systems; SQL database, ERP implementation and M&A experience beneficial.
- Stakeholder Engagement: Proven ability to build strong relationships and collaborate effectively across functions with a customer-focused mindset.
- Strategic & Operational Agility: Adept at planning, time management, and driving initiatives to completion with a proactive, flexible work style.
- Sector Knowledge: Experience in the human services sector preferred, with a strong understanding of business needs and performance improvement.
